Introduction The Rasfox DAC1922 Converter will convert a standard digital audio signal (Coaxial or Toslink jack ) to standard FL / FR stereo audio signals (RCA output jack) so you can use it to connect the new media hardware (digital audio output only) to an older audio amplification device with FL / FR RCA input only.

Specifications For Model DAC1922: Support Audio Format PCM / LPCM Signal-to-Noise Ratio 105DB Separating Degree (1KHZ) 94DB Response Frequency 20~20KHz -0.2db THD+N -90DB Total Harmonic Distortion 10Hz~20KHz 0.25-0.065% (THD) Blocking Time 0.577Fs Sampling Rate 32~192 KHz Bit Rate 16~24 Bit Maximum Output Power 0.3W...
